2nd Nine Weeks |
2.1b Understand, infer, and make simple predictions. 2.1b5 Make a prediction about narrative or informational text and confirm or revise the prediction
AAE Can name the setting of a story AAE Can follow one and two step written and oral directions AAE Can dictate a story (Language Experience) AAE Can differentiate reality from fiction

2b Apply knowledge of phonological and phonemic awareness (DOK2) 2.2b1 Identify and produce rhyming rhyming words orally that include consonant blends and digraphs. (ex. trap/snap, flat/splat, sing/ring) 2.2b7 blend and segment words in spoken words containing initial and final blends. 2.1c use word recognition skills (DOK1) 2.1c1 Generate the sounds from all letters and letter patterns (including consonant blends, consonant digraphs, short and long vowel patterns, and blend those sounds into recognizable words (ex. /fl/, /tr/, /sl/, /sm/, /sn/, /bl/, /gr/, /str/

2.1a Use an appropriate composing process (e.g., planning, drafting, revising, editing, publishing, sharing) to compose or edit. 2.1a2 drafting-put thoughts on paper using words and sentences 2.1c Compose a narrative with a beginning, middle, and end. 2.2c2 compose drawings/visual images to tell stories with a beginning, middle, and end
AAE Can write at least two sentences to communicate an idea
|
2.2b Use Standard English mechanics 2.2b4 Begin to use apostrophes (e.g. contractions)
AAE Definition of a sentence AAE Identify telling and asking sentences AAE Can identify a noun (common, proper, singular, plural) AAE Can make a noun plural AAE Can chop a sentence between the naming and action part AAE Can identify the subject of a sentence AAE Can identify the predicate of a sentence
